Studio Electronics ATC-1 Analog Synthesizer

via this auction

"comes with external filter cartridges (shown in picture on top of unit) that are fully analog clones of the Roland TB303, ARP 2600 & Oberheim SEM filters. There is an external audio input, so you can run any audio through the filters you like. It aslo has CV / gate out, so it can be used to convert midi to CV/gate signal which can be used to control older analog synthesizers that were manufactured without midi."

VOICE of SATURN SYNTH BOUTIQUE ANALOG

via this auction

"VOICE of SATURN BOUTIQUE ANALOG SYNTHESIZER ATARI DESIGN
Loosely based on the Atari Punk Console with some custom tweaks and an LFO front end, this box makes a ridiculous amount of different sounds, all from three 555s. Comes as a bare-bones kit (assembled), an everything-kit with knobs and case, and a fully-assembled and tested version. It's open source and has small area on the pcb for easy circuit bending."

LinnDrum & Jupiter-8 demo


YouTube via SynthManiaDotCom — June 21, 2010 — "I got a LinnDrum today and thought about making a demo video showcasing two of the most iconic 1980s instrument: the Linn and the Jupiter-8.

All drum sounds are from the LinnDrum LM-2, all the synth sounds are from the Roland Jupiter-8.

Most of the song is me improvising, but there is a little cameo - The Twins' "Face to face, heart to heart"."

Pittsburgh Modular VILFO Synthesizer Module Influence Control Voltage Test


YouTube via amphonic — June 21, 2010 — "Here is a quick video showing the Voltage Influence in action. The VILFO on the left is sent to the volt/octave input of a dot com oscillator playing a triangle wave. A second VILFO (on the right) is routed to the "Influence Control Voltage" input of the VILFO on the left. Only the VILFO on the left is controlling the oscillator.
